KPMG's Business
Measurement ProcessThe 21st Century Public Company Audit, a new monograph co-authored by Timothy B. Bell (KPMG LLP), Mark E. Peecher and Ira Solomon (University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ign) discusses conceptual underpinnings of risk assessment, evidence gathering, and other professional judgment activities that are pervasive in 21st century public company audits.
Information technology is bringing dramatic changes to business models and strategies, to business processes, and to business measurement, including accounting. Such changes necessitate fundamental and pervasive reconsideration of financial-statement audit technology. In a monograph entitled, Auditing Organizations Through a Strategic-Systems Lens, two leading practitioners and two leading scholars present their thinking on the foundations of auditing technology for the twenty-first century. KPMG's Business Measurement Process is used therein to illustrate key concepts and ideas.
